Badminton has five categories — men's singles, women's singles, men's doubles, women's doubles, and mixed doubles. Each category has its own dynamics, and a player who dominates in one may not be as predictable in another. yes2win offers separate markets for each category across major tournaments.

Point Handicap Within a Set

Beyond the overall set handicap, some markets offer point handicaps within a specific set. For example, if the odds show -3.5 points for Player A in the first set, Player A must win that set by more than 3 points for the bet to succeed. This is a high-volatility market that requires in-depth knowledge of each player's playing style.

Reading Badminton Odds — A Practical Example

Badminton odds on yes2win are displayed in decimal format. Here's a neutral example to help you understand the basic calculation.

Odds Calculation Example

Say Player A (world ranked 3) is up against Player B (world ranked 18). The odds for Player A to win are 1.45 and Player B wins is 2.80.

  • If you bet RM100 on Player A (odds 1.45): total payout = RM145, net profit = RM45
  • If you bet RM100 on Player B (odds 2.80): total payout = RM280, net profit = RM180

Lower odds indicate a more favoured player, but the returns are smaller. The right pick ultimately comes down to your own analysis of the match.
